Litigation and criminal, regulatory liabilities, investigation and compliance.
Rui joined the firm in 1994 and became a Partner in 2005. He co-heads the criminal, regulatory offences and compliance department. He is one of the firm’s most experienced lawyers in the area of litigation, having developed the area of criminal and regulatory offences litigation. He also has extensive activity in the area of compliance, integrity, investigation, civil litigation and national arbitration.
Former university Professor of law (1994-2013) and Guest Professor in litigation law master starting 2020.
Rui was a member of the Judiciary Superior Council and a member of the Corruption Prevention Council. He was Member of the Board of the Modern and Contemporary Art Foundation - Berardo Collection by appointment of the Ministry of Culture. In April 2023, he was appointed by the Portuguese government as a substitute member of the Venice Commission of the Council of Europe. Currently he is member of the OPCR’s executive board (Observatório Português de Compliance e Regulatório). He also co-coordinates BeNAC - Barómetro da Aplicação da Estratégia Nacional Anticorrupção (Observatório Permanente da Justiça – Centro de Estudos Sociais da Universidade de Coimbra), among other positions and functions.
Portuguese Bar Association (admitted in 1996). European Criminal Bar Association. Portuguese Arbitration Association. Criminal Forum.
Author and co-author of several criminal, misdemeanours and compliance law books and articles, as well as other litigation, regulatory, justice and professional activity of lawyers matters.
Law degree (University of Lisbon, 1994). Master's degree in criminal law (University of Lisbon, 1999).
